The Mechanism Behind Laser Therapy



When you think about exactly how laser treatment works, it's fascinating to see that it utilizes focused light energy to target details cells in the body. This energy stimulates cellular processes, boosting blood circulation and promoting healing.

By delivering specific wavelengths, lasers can permeate deeper layers of skin without destructive bordering areas. You could notice that this method substantially decreases pain and inflammation, as the light power engages with cells to speed up regeneration.

Additionally, laser therapy can urge collagen production, which is vital for cells fixing. The non-invasive nature of this treatment indicates quicker healing times, making it an attractive alternative for various conditions.

Understanding these mechanisms helps you value the transformative potential of laser innovation in medical care.

Applications of Laser Therapy in Modern Medication



As you check out the applications of laser treatment in contemporary medicine, you'll uncover its convenience across various fields.

In dermatology, lasers treat conditions like acne scars, pigmentation, and unwanted hair. You'll see their effectiveness in ophthalmology, fixing vision via procedures like LASIK.

In orthopedics, laser treatment aids hurting alleviation and faster recuperation from injuries. It additionally plays an essential function in dentistry, doing exact surgeries and teeth whitening.

In addition, laser treatment is used in oncology to diminish tumors and ease pain from cancer therapies. You might also discover it in plastic surgery, boosting skin structure and lowering creases.

Each application highlights the modern technology's potential to improve individual outcomes and change typical treatment methods.
